A » A reputable IT provider in Leeds demonstrates transparent pricing, scalable services, and proactive support aligned with your business goals. Seek local references, clear service-level agreements, and a track record of cost-effective solutions. Prioritising vendors who avoid unnecessary add-ons ensures quality without overspending.

A »Look for a provider with clear, upfront pricing and no hidden fees – that's key to avoiding overspending. Check local Leeds reviews and ask for client references. A reliable sign is proactive support that prevents issues before they cost you. Also, ensure they offer flexible, scalable plans so you only pay for what you actually need right now.
